Performs right-multiplication of a data matrix `X` by a kernel matrix `Kern`,
optionally with symmetric normalization.
Usage
convolve_matrix(X, Kern, normalize = FALSE)
Arguments
- X
A data matrix to be transformed (n x p).
- Kern
A square kernel matrix (p x p) used for the transformation.
- normalize
A logical flag indicating whether to apply symmetric normalization
D^(-1/2) Kern D^(-1/2) before multiplication (default: FALSE).
Value
A matrix resulting from X %*% Kern (or normalized version).
